Unlock the Power of Impart API: Revolutionize Your AI Experience!
Introduction
In the rapidly evolving landscape of technology, APIs have become the backbone of modern applications. They facilitate seamless integration between different systems, enabling businesses to leverage the power of various services and technologies. Among these, AI APIs have emerged as a game-changer, offering businesses the ability to integrate intelligent capabilities into their applications. Impart API, an innovative AI Gateway and API Developer Portal, is at the forefront of this revolution. In this comprehensive guide, we will delve into the features, benefits, and usage scenarios of Impart API, showcasing how it can transform your AI experience.
Understanding Impart API
Impart API is an open-source AI gateway and API developer portal designed to simplify the integration, management, and deployment of AI and REST services. It is built on the Apache 2.0 license, making it freely available to developers and enterprises worldwide. By providing a unified management system for authentication, cost tracking, and API lifecycle management, Impart API empowers users to harness the full potential of AI technologies.
Key Features of Impart API
1. Quick Integration of 100+ AI Models
Impart API offers seamless integration with over 100 AI models, allowing developers to choose the right model for their specific needs. This feature simplifies the process of integrating AI capabilities into applications, saving time and effort.
2. Unified API Format for AI Invocation
Impart API standardizes the request data format across all AI models, ensuring that changes in AI models or prompts do not affect the application or microservices. This simplifies AI usage and maintenance costs, making it easier for developers to work with AI APIs.
3. Prompt Encapsulation into REST API
Users can quickly combine AI models with custom prompts to create new APIs, such as sentiment analysis, translation, or data analysis APIs. This feature allows developers to easily create custom AI-powered services without needing deep AI expertise.
4. End-to-End API Lifecycle Management
Impart API assists with managing the entire lifecycle of APIs, including design, publication, invocation, and decommission. It helps regulate API management processes, manage traffic forwarding, load balancing, and versioning of published APIs.
5. API Service Sharing within Teams
The platform allows for the centralized display of all API services, making it easy for different departments and teams to find and use the required API services. This feature promotes collaboration and ensures that all team members have access to the necessary resources.
6. Independent API and Access Permissions for Each Tenant
Impart API enables the creation of multiple teams (tenants), each with independent applications, data, user configurations, and security policies. This feature improves resource utilization and reduces operational costs while maintaining a high level of security.
7. API Resource Access Requires Approval
APIPark allows for the activation of subscription approval features, ensuring that callers must subscribe to an API and await administrator approval before they can invoke it. This prevents unauthorized API calls and potential data breaches.
8. Performance Rivaling Nginx
With just an 8-core CPU and 8GB of memory, Impart API can achieve over 20,000 TPS, supporting cluster deployment to handle large-scale traffic. This performance makes it a reliable choice for high-demand applications.
9. Detailed API Call Logging
Impart API provides comprehensive logging capabilities, recording every detail of each API call. This feature allows businesses to quickly trace and troubleshoot issues in API calls, ensuring system stability and data security.
10. Powerful Data Analysis
Impart API analyzes historical call data to display long-term trends and performance changes, helping businesses with preventive maintenance before issues occur.
APIPark is a high-performance AI gateway that allows you to securely access the most comprehensive LLM APIs globally on the APIPark platform, including OpenAI, Anthropic, Mistral, Llama2, Google Gemini, and more.Try APIPark now! πππ
Deployment and Usage
Deploying Impart API is a straightforward process. With a single command line, you can quickly set up and start using the platform. Here's how:
curl -sSO https://download.apipark.com/install/quick-start.sh; bash quick-start.sh
Once deployed, you can leverage the platform's features to integrate AI models, manage APIs, and create custom AI-powered services.
APIPark - Open Source AI Gateway & API Management Platform
APIPark is an open-source AI gateway and API management platform that complements Impart API. It provides a comprehensive set of tools for managing APIs, including API design, testing, and deployment. APIPark is built on the Apache 2.0 license, making it freely available to developers and enterprises.
Key Features of APIPark
1. API Design and Development
APIPark offers a user-friendly interface for designing and developing APIs. It supports various protocols, including REST, GraphQL, and WebSocket, and provides tools for API testing and debugging.
2. API Testing and Monitoring
APIPark allows you to test and monitor your APIs in real-time. You can simulate different scenarios and verify the behavior of your APIs, ensuring that they meet your requirements.
3. API Deployment and Management
APIPark provides tools for deploying and managing APIs in production environments. It supports various deployment options, including cloud-based and on-premises solutions.
4. API Analytics and Reporting
APIPark offers detailed analytics and reporting capabilities, allowing you to track API usage, performance, and errors. This information can help you optimize your APIs and improve their overall quality.
Conclusion
Impart API and APIPark are powerful tools for integrating AI and REST services into your applications. By leveraging these platforms, you can unlock the full potential of AI technologies and revolutionize your AI experience. Whether you're a developer or an enterprise, these tools can help you simplify the process of integrating AI capabilities into your applications, saving time and resources.
FAQs
Q1: What is Impart API? A1: Impart API is an open-source AI gateway and API developer portal designed to simplify the integration, management, and deployment of AI and REST services.
Q2: Can Impart API integrate with other AI models? A2: Yes, Impart API offers seamless integration with over 100 AI models, allowing developers to choose the right model for their specific needs.
Q3: How does Impart API help with API lifecycle management? A3: Impart API assists with managing the entire lifecycle of APIs, including design, publication, invocation, and decommission, simplifying the process of working with APIs.
Q4: What is the performance of Impart API? A4: Impart API can achieve over 20,000 TPS with just an 8-core CPU and 8GB of memory, making it a reliable choice for high-demand applications.
Q5: Can I use Impart API with APIPark? A5: Yes, Impart API and APIPark are complementary tools that can be used together to simplify the process of integrating AI and REST services into your applications.
πYou can securely and efficiently call the OpenAI API on APIPark in just two steps:
Step 1: Deploy the APIPark AI gateway in 5 minutes.
APIPark is developed based on Golang, offering strong product performance and low development and maintenance costs. You can deploy APIPark with a single command line.
curl -sSO https://download.apipark.com/install/quick-start.sh; bash quick-start.sh

In my experience, you can see the successful deployment interface within 5 to 10 minutes. Then, you can log in to APIPark using your account.

Step 2: Call the OpenAI API.
